Analysis from the IIHS reveals that the rear occupants are actually at the next danger of a deadly harm than these seated within the entrance of a car. Nevertheless, knowledge reveals it has nothing to do with the cabin design. Quite the opposite, it is as a result of the frontal space has turn into safer with superior airbags and security belts, options which might be not often out there for rear passengers.
In response to this rising concern, the IIHS debuted its average overlap entrance crash check final yr, and the company added a brand new check dummy with strain sensors within the backseat behind the driving force. The check dummy is in regards to the measurement of a petite lady or a 12-year-old little one. For a car to get a Good ranking, there ought to be no “extreme danger of harm to the pinnacle, neck, chest or thigh” of the dummy, and it should “stay accurately positioned throughout the crash with out sliding ahead beneath the lap belt (or ‘submarining’).”
